What is Fire Safety Compliance?

Fire safety compliance involves meeting the legal and regulatory fire safety standards set by UK legislation. This includes implementing fire protection measures such as fire stopping, fire compartmentation, and intumescent coatings to ensure the safety of your building and its occupants.

The Fire Safety Order is one of the key pieces of legislation that requires businesses to carry out a fire risk assessment and take steps to prevent and control the spread of fire.

What are the Risks of Not Prioritising Fire Safety Compliance?

Failing to prioritise fire safety compliance can result in serious consequences for your business, including:

Legal and financial penalties:

Non-compliance with fire safety regulations can lead to fines, legal action, and even forced closure. The costs of fines and possible shutdowns far outweigh the cost of proper fire protection measures.

Safety and liability:

Poor fire safety measures put employees, customers, and visitors at risk. If a fire happens, businesses could face liability claims and insurance disputes.

Reputational damage:

News of a fire-related incident can spread quickly, and failure to meet fire safety standards can damage your business’ reputation and destroy customer trust.

Business disruption:

Fires or fire-related accidents can lead to significant downtime, which can affect productivity and revenue. With the right safety measures, you can prevent expensive interruptions.

How Fire Safety Compliance Protects Your Business

Fire safety compliance is essential for both meeting legal requirements and safeguarding your business. Here’s why:

Protecting employees and customers:

Compliant fire protection makes sure that everyone in your building is safe in the event of a fire, providing clear escape routes and working fire alarms.

Safeguarding property and assets:

Fire protection systems help prevent extensive damage to your building’s structure and valuable assets, reducing the risk of costly repairs or loss of equipment.

Ensuring business continuity:

By maintaining fire safety compliance, you can prevent operational disruptions and protect your business from the financial impact of a fire-related incident.

Lowering insurance costs:

Insurance premiums may be lower for businesses that have comprehensive fire protection measures, as they reduce the risk of expensive claims.
